Output 52fd2df35ec2d2300143d8f0c60fe35c28aff6cae77cc39d8eddc72eed42c03c:1

value
2993942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7b266ee556a3f31cedff7f6c286a90888f36c84 OP_EQUAL
address
3Np7jT44uEzYZeYZqzbT5c28shs6zDjb2w
transaction
52fd2df35ec2d2300143d8f0c60fe35c28aff6cae77cc39d8eddc72eed42c03c
spent
true